Florian Meier | 96286b5 | 2014-01-06 20:18:24 +0100 | [diff] [blame] | 1 | * BCM2835 DMA controller |
| 2 | |
| 3 | The BCM2835 DMA controller has 16 channels in total. |
| 4 | Only the lower 13 channels have an associated IRQ. |
| 5 | Some arbitrary channels are used by the firmware |
| 6 | (1,3,6,7 in the current firmware version). |
| 7 | The channels 0,2 and 3 have special functionality |
| 8 | and should not be used by the driver. |
| 9 | |
| 10 | Required properties: |
| 11 | - compatible: Should be "brcm,bcm2835-dma". |
| 12 | - reg: Should contain DMA registers location and length. |
| 13 | - interrupts: Should contain the DMA interrupts associated |
| 14 | to the DMA channels in ascending order. |
Martin Sperl | e7679db | 2016-04-11 13:29:07 +0000 | [diff] [blame] | 15 | - interrupt-names: Should contain the names of the interrupt |
| 16 | in the form "dmaXX". |
| 17 | Use "dma-shared-all" for the common interrupt line |
| 18 | that is shared by all dma channels. |
Florian Meier | 96286b5 | 2014-01-06 20:18:24 +0100 | [diff] [blame] | 19 | - #dma-cells: Must be <1>, the cell in the dmas property of the |
| 20 | client device represents the DREQ number. |
| 21 | - brcm,dma-channel-mask: Bit mask representing the channels |
| 22 | not used by the firmware in ascending order, |
| 23 | i.e. first channel corresponds to LSB. |

Florian Meier | 96286b5 | 2014-01-06 20:18:24 +0100 | [diff] [blame] | 70 | DMA clients connected to the BCM2835 DMA controller must use the format |
| 71 | described in the dma.txt file, using a two-cell specifier for each channel. |
